Level 5 Operations or Departmental Manager


Duration 22 months

An Operations or departmental manager is someone who manages teams and/or projects, and achieving operational or departmental goals and objectives, as part of the delivery of the organisations strategy. They are accountable to a more senior manager or business owner. Working in the private, public or third sector and in all sizes of organisation, specific responsibilities and job titles will vary, but the knowledge, skills and behaviours needed will be the same. Key responsibilities may include creating and delivering operational plans, managing projects, leading and managing teams, managing change, financial and resource management, talent management, coaching and mentoring.

Apprenticeship Qualifications

On successful completion of the programme, the apprentice will be awarded with a Level 5 Operations / Departmental Manager apprenticeship certificate. They will also achieve one of the following: CMI L5 Diploma in Management & Leadership or ILM L4 Diploma for Leaders and Managers.
